     ─ Release notes ─────────────────────────────────────── ─── ─ ─

     With the Internet able to build up or tear down artists
     almost as soon as they start practicing, the advance
     word and intense scrutiny doesn't always do a band any
     favors. By the time they've got a full-length album
     ready to go, the trend-spotters are already several Hot
     New Bands past them. Vampire Weekend started generating
     buzz in 2006 -- not long after they formed -- but their
     self-titled debut album didn't arrive until early 2008.
     Vampire Weekend also has just a handful of songs that
     haven't been floating around the 'Net, which may
     disappoint the kind of people who like to post "First!"
     on message boards. This doesn't make those songs any
     less charming, however -- in fact, the band has spent
     the last year and a half making them even more
     charming, perfecting the culture collision of indie-,
     chamber-, and Afro-pop they call "Upper West Side
     Soweto" by making that unique hybrid of sounds feel
     completely effortless. So, Vampire Weekend ends up
     being a more or less official validation of the long-
     building buzz around the band, served up in packaging
     that uses the Futura typeface almost as stylishly as
     Wes Anderson. At times, the album sounds like someone
     trying to turn a Wes Anderson movie back into music
     (it's no surprise that the band's keyboardist also
     writes film scores); there's a similarly precious yet
     adventurous feel here, as well as a kindred eye and ear
     for detail. Everything is concise, concentrated,
     distilled, vivid; Vampire Weekend's world is extremely
     specific and meticulously crafted, and Vampire Weekend
     often feels like a concept album about preppy guys who
     grew up with classical music and recently got really
     into world music. Amazingly, instead of being
     alienating, the band's quirks are utterly winning.
     Scholarly grammar ("Oxford Comma") and architecture
     ("Mansard Roof") are springboards for songs with
     impulsive melodies, tricky rhythms, and syncopated
     basslines. Strings and harpsichords brush up against
     African-inspired chants on "M79," and lilting Afro-pop
     guitars and a skanking beat give way to Mellotrons on
     "A-Punk." It's a given that a band that's this high
     concept has hyper-literate lyrics: the singer's name is
     the very writerly Ezra Koenig, and you almost expect to
     see footnotes in the album's liner notes. Once again,
     though, Vampire Weekend's words are evocative instead
     of gimmicky. The irresistible "Cape Cod Kwassa Kwassa"
     rhymes "Louis Vuitton" with "reggaeton" and "Benneton"
     and name-drops Peter Gabriel (though it's clear the
     band spent more time with Paul Simon's Graceland)
     without feeling contrived. "Campus" is another
     standout, with lines like "I see you walking across the
     campus...how am I supposed to pretend I never want to
     see you again?" throwing listeners into college life no
     matter what their age. Koenig has a boyish, hopeful
     quality to his voice that completes Vampire Weekend,
     especially on bittersweet but irrepressible songs like
     "I Stand Corrected" and album closer "The Kids Don't
     Stand a Chance." Fully realized debut albums like
     Vampire Weekend come along once in a great while, and
     these songs show that this band is smart, but not too
     smart for their own good.
